Microsoft is rolling out a significant update to Windows 11 that simplifies how users set default applications, addressing one of the most common pain points in the operating system. This change comes as part of Microsoft's ongoing effort to refine the Windows 11 user experience based on community feedback.

The Challenge with Default Apps in Windows 11

Since its launch, Windows 11 has faced criticism for making it unnecessarily complicated to change default applications. Users reported frustration with:

  • Multiple steps required to change simple associations
  • Forced redirection to Settings app for basic changes
  • Lack of clear file type associations
  • Microsoft Edge being aggressively promoted as the default browser

What's Changing in the New Update

The latest Windows 11 update (version 23H2) introduces several improvements:

Simplified Default App Selection

  1. One-Click Default Setting: Users can now set default apps directly from context menus
  2. Unified Interface: All default app controls consolidated in Settings > Apps > Default apps
  3. File Type Associations: Clearer mapping between file types and applications
  4. Protocol Handling: Better visibility for URL protocol handlers

Technical Improvements

  • New API for developers to register their apps as defaults
  • Reduced system prompts when changing defaults
  • Persistent default app settings across updates

How to Change Default Apps in Windows 11 (New Method)

Here's the streamlined process:

  1. Right-click on any file of the type you want to change
  2. Select "Open with" > "Choose another app"
  3. Check "Always use this app" and select your preferred application
  4. For browser defaults, visit Settings > Apps > Default apps and select your browser

Microsoft's Changing Approach

This update represents a shift in Microsoft's strategy regarding default apps:

  • Reduced emphasis on pushing Microsoft Edge
  • More respect for user choice
  • Alignment with EU Digital Markets Act requirements
  • Response to widespread user complaints

Impact on Users and Developers

For users:
- Faster workflow when setting up new devices
- Less frustration when installing alternative browsers/media players
- More intuitive controls for less technical users

For developers:
- Fairer competition for alternative app developers
- Clearer guidelines for registering applications
- Reduced instances of Windows overriding user choices

Future Outlook

Microsoft has indicated this is part of a broader initiative to:

  • Continue refining default app handling
  • Potentially decouple more system components
  • Improve compliance with global regulations
  • Further simplify the Windows 11 interface

Troubleshooting Tips

If you experience issues with default apps after the update:

  1. Run the Windows App Troubleshooter
  2. Reset all defaults via Settings > Apps > Default apps > Reset
  3. Check for app-specific default settings
  4. Ensure your applications are fully updated

This update marks a positive step in Microsoft's relationship with Windows users, demonstrating responsiveness to feedback while maintaining system integrity.